Distributed Lock Manager Messages
The Distributed Lock Manager (DLM) generates error messages if it
detects that a filesystem operation will block indefinitely because of an
internal error. The DLM also generates error messages if the dlm process
is failing. If you receive one of these errors, report it to PolyServe
Technical Support at your earliest convenience.
The error messages have the following format:
time/date stamp:error:message text
Typically, you will need to reboot the affected server to recover from the
error condition.
SANPulse Error Messages
SANPulse sends two types of messages to the matrix.log file: error and
fatal.
Error messages have the following format:
[Error ] [<date and time>] SANPulse SERVERS Internal error: ...
These messages indicate that an internal error has occurred in the
SANPulse component. If you receive an error message, report it to
PolyServe Technical Support at your earliest convenience.
